    Why is there no air flow from my BedJet Temperature Controller into the bed?
    • S
      Shelly RangelAug 3, 2025
      If your BedJet is on but you're not feeling the cooling or heating in bed, several factors could be at play. First, check that the Air Nozzle and Air Hose are properly installed on the bed, as they can shift over time. Ensure the bedding isn't bunched up in front of the Air Nozzle. Also, low-quality top sheets (too low thread count) or loose-knit top sheets might allow air to escape. A heavy blanket load can also impede airflow. To resolve this, adjust the Air Nozzle and Hose so that the Air Nozzle extends at least 1 inch onto the top of the mattress. Pull the bedding flatter to allow air to flow through the bed. Use a top layer sheet or comforter with a 250 thread count or higher. Consider using the AirComforter accessory.

    What to do if my BedJet 6002NA V1 blows cold air while in heat mode?
    • J
      james68Aug 13, 2025
      If your BedJet delivers warm air but then starts blowing cold air while still in heat mode, the mechanical thermal overheat switches may have been triggered, possibly by inlet or outlet blockages. To fix this, switch off your BedJet and unplug it for 5 minutes. Then, plug it back in and run it on cool mode for 1 minute before attempting to use the heat mode again. This will help reset the thermal overheat switch. Also, check the air filter to ensure it is clean and make sure there are no obstructions blocking the air inlet or outlet.

    What does it mean when my BedJet 6002NA V1 beeps 5 times and the power LED is flashing?
    • E
      Eric PeckAug 21, 2025
      If the BedJet Power LED is flashing, all other LED lights are off, the unit won't operate, and the BedJet beeps 5 times, it indicates the microprocessor has detected a monitoring error. This can occur if you rapidly change modes or airflow while obstructing inlets or outlets. To resolve this, shut the BedJet off for 10 seconds and restart it. If the problem persists, contact BedJet support and record the number of flashes from the Power LED. Also, ensure the air filter is clean and there are no obstructions in the air inlet or outlet. For V2 models, update the firmware.

BedJet 6002NA V1 Specifications

General IconGeneral
ModelBedJet 6002NA V1
CategoryTemperature Controller
Power120V / 60Hz
Cooling MethodAir
Heating MethodAir
Temperature Range66°F to 104°F (19°C to 40°C)
Control MethodWireless remote control, mobile app
CompatibilityTwin, Full, Queen, King Size Beds
